深入解析以太坊钱包的私钥与公钥编码机制

              发布时间:2025-04-07 20:02:58
              ``` ## 内容主体大纲 1. **引言** - 以太坊平台的概述 - 钱包的重要性 - 私钥与公钥的基本概念 2. **以太坊钱包的构成** - 钱包的种类 - 钱包的功能 3. **私钥与公钥的生成** - 随机数生成和加密算法 - 生成公钥与私钥的关系 4. **私钥的安全性问题** - 私钥的重要性 - 常见的安全隐患及应对措施 5. **公钥的使用** - 如何使用公钥进行地址生成 - 公钥在交易中的作用 6. **私钥与公钥编码的技术细节** - 编码算法概述 - Base58与Hex编码的对比 7. **如何安全地管理私钥** - 存储选项比较 - 恢复私钥的方法与注意事项 8. **总结** - 私钥与公钥的重要性 - 安全管理的最佳实践 --- ## 正文内容 ### 引言

              以太坊是一个全球分布式的区块链平台,以其智能合约功能而闻名。用户需要使用电子钱包来存储和管理他们的数字资产。钱包里主要包含私钥和公钥,这些钥匙是用户进行交易和身份验证的关键。

              私钥是用户持有数字资产的唯一凭证,而公钥则用于生成地址并验证交易。不了解私钥和公钥的内在关系,可能导致资产的丢失或安全隐患。本文将深入探讨以太坊钱包中私钥与公钥的编码机制,帮助用户更深入地理解这些重要概念。

              ### 以太坊钱包的构成

              以太坊钱包主要分为热钱包和冷钱包。热钱包连接到互联网,适合频繁交易;冷钱包离线存储,更加安全,适合长期持有资产。钱包的功能不仅限于存储,还包括发送和接收以太币,并与智能合约交互。

              ### 私钥与公钥的生成

              私钥是通过加密算法生成的随机数,通常由256位的二进制数构成。公钥则是私钥经过椭圆曲线加密算法(ECDSA)生成的,它与私钥的关系密切,任何拥有私钥的人都可以生成对应的公钥,而反之则不然。

              ### 私钥的安全性问题

              私钥的重要性毋庸置疑,任何人只要拥有你的私钥,就能完全控制你的数字资产。常见的安全隐患包括网络钓鱼、恶意软件和不安全的存储介质。用户应采取多重认证、冷存储等措施来保护私钥。

              ### 公钥的使用

              公钥的主要作用在于生成以太坊地址。以太坊地址是公钥的哈希值,是其他用户发送以太币时所需的信息。公钥还在交易中起到验证身份的作用,确保交易的合法性和可信性。

              ### 私钥与公钥编码的技术细节

              以太坊使用多种编码方式来表示私钥和公钥。最常见的有Hex(十六进制)和Base58编码。Hex编码直观简单,而Base58则消除了容易混淆的字符,提升了用户的使用体验。

              ### 如何安全地管理私钥

              私钥管理至关重要,用户应选择安全的存储方式,如硬件钱包或纸钱包。必要时,可以使用助记词进行私钥的备份和恢复。无论选择何种方式,都需要确保设备的安全性,避免遭受攻击。

              ### 总结

              私钥和公钥在以太坊数字资产管理中扮演着不可替代的角色。了解其生成、编码与管理方法,有助于用户更加安全地进行数字资产交易。选择合适的安全措施和管理策略,是保护个人财富的关键。

              --- ## 相关问题及详细介绍 ###

              1. 什么是以太坊钱包,如何工作?

              以太坊钱包是一种用于存储以太坊及其代币的应用程序,允许用户在区块链上进行交易。钱包并不存储资产,实则存储的是管理这些资产的私钥。

              工作原理方面,当用户需要发送以太币时,他们会在钱包中输入接收地址和金额,钱包随后会利用私钥对交易进行签名。交易记录被发送到以太坊网络,由矿工确认并写入区块。通过这种机制,用户可以安全地管理资产而不必依赖中心化服务。

              以太坊钱包分为热钱包和冷钱包,热钱包适合频繁交易,冷钱包则适合长时间存储。用户需要根据自己的需求选择不同类型的钱包,以确保资产的安全性。

              ###

              2. 私钥为什么如此重要?如何保证私钥的安全?

              
深入解析以太坊钱包的私钥与公钥编码机制

              私钥是用户访问和控制以太坊钱包的关键,任何人获取私钥都可能导致资产的丢失。因此,确保私钥的安全至关重要。可选的一些安全措施包括:

              1. **使用硬件钱包:** 硬件钱包提供了离线存储,可以有效防止黑客攻击。 2. **不要将私钥存储在云端:** 由于云存储的安全隐患,存储私钥时应选择彻底离线的方式。 3. **定期备份私钥:** 备份私钥并将备份安全存放在多个物理位置。 4. **开启多重认证:** 若钱包提供多重认证功能,务必使用,以增加账户的安全性。

              通过这些措施,用户可以最大限度地降低私钥被盗的风险,确保资产的安全。

              ###

              3. 公钥与私钥是如何相互关联的?

              公钥与私钥之间存在密切的数学关系。公钥是由私钥通过椭圆曲线算法生成的。用户在创建钱包时会随机生成私钥,并且只要掌握了私钥,就可以生成对应的公钥。这种关系确保了在交易中可以通过公钥验证私钥的签名,确保交易的合法性。

              虽然公钥可以用于验证交易,但是无法反向推导出私钥,因此保护私钥的安全至关重要。任何用户都可以查看公钥,而私钥则必须严格保密。

              ###

              4. 如何生成以太坊地址?

              
深入解析以太坊钱包的私钥与公钥编码机制

              以太坊地址是在公钥的基础上生成的,它是公钥经过Keccak-256哈希算法计算后取出后20个字节的一种表示。具体步骤如下:

              1. **生成公钥:** 使用私钥生成公钥。 2. **哈希处理:** 将公钥进行Keccak-256哈希处理。 3. **生成地址:** 从哈希结果中取出后20个字节并添加前缀“0x”,即为以太坊地址。

              以太坊地址与公钥并不是一一对应的,但使用公钥可以随时生成对应的地址。地址是用于接收以太币和执行交易的主要标识符。

              ###

              5. 谁能够生成以太坊的钱包私钥和公钥?

              任何人都可以创建以太坊钱包,并生成私钥和公钥。用户通常使用专用的钱包软件、硬件钱包或者在线服务來创建钱包。在生成过程中,随机数生成算法会产生一个保密的私钥,而私钥对应的公钥则由钱包软件自动生成。

              值得注意的是,由于私钥的生成是完全随机的,这意味着每个人生成的私钥都是独一无二的。使用多种算法和安全机制可以提高生成私钥的安全性,因此每个用户都应该确保使用可靠的软件或者硬件。

              ###

              6. 如何使用助记词恢复钱包私钥?

              助记词是一种方便的方式来备份和恢复钱包中的私钥。通常情况下,助记词由一组随机单词组成,这组单词可以用来生成和恢复你的私钥。恢复步骤如下:

              1. **下载支持助记词的以太坊钱包:** 确保安装钱包应用程序,并能够处理助记词。 2. **选择恢复钱包选项:** 在应用程序主界面中选择“恢复钱包”或类似的选项。 3. **输入助记词:** 按照提示输入助记词,钱包会自动利用这些单词生成私钥。 4. **完成恢复:** 完成所有步骤后,用户可以重新访问他们的钱包及其资产。

              在使用助记词时,务必要确保这些单词不会被其他人看到,因为任何人获取在这些助记词的内容都能够恢复钱包,并控制你所有的资金。

              分享 :
                  author

                  tpwallet

                  T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                    相关新闻

                                    全面解读中国数字货币发
                                    2024-12-30
                                    全面解读中国数字货币发

                                    ## 内容主体大纲1. **引言** - 现代金融科技的发展 - 数字货币的崛起 - 中国数字货币的背景2. **中国数字货币的定义与...

                                    以太坊私有链钱包的完全
                                    2025-02-27
                                    以太坊私有链钱包的完全

                                    ## 内容大纲1. **引言** - 介绍以太坊私有链的背景 - 钱包的基本概念和重要性2. **以太坊私有链的基础知识** - 如何创建...

                                      央行数字货币的投放公司
                                    2025-03-19
                                    央行数字货币的投放公司

                                    内容大纲 1. 引言 - 数字货币的背景与发展 - 央行数字货币的概念与重要性 2. 央行数字货币的基本概念 - 央行数字货币...

                                    郑州警方成功破获一起数
                                    2025-01-21
                                    郑州警方成功破获一起数

                                    ### 内容主体大纲1. **引言** - 数字货币的崛起与影响 - 郑州警方的行动背景2. **案件经过** - 事件的起因 - 调查过程详...

                                                    <style lang="jnrr78m"></style><time id="kjn18t0"></time><legend draggable="5v2370q"></legend><i lang="fr7figc"></i><font lang="y3zz_1d"></font><noframes date-time="avtj2g6">